Here’s one simple and inexpensive idea for Christmas decorating that I tried several years ago. I happened to be shopping in Target and came across some really pretty Christmas gift bags. I thought they were so pretty, with all their sparkle, that rather than use them to hold gifts I chose to frame one of them instead. A 50% discounted black frame from Michaels was all I needed to have the perfect Christmas themed picture for my mantle. So quick and easy!
